Wilton Bridge Maintenance Works (B1112)

Suffolk Highways have given us advance notice of road closures, as follows.


I am writing to inform you of upcoming essential bridge maintenance works proposed to take place at Wilton Bridge on Station Road (B1112), Lakenheath which may have an effect on the surrounding parishes.

The construction programme is due to take no more than 15 weeks beginning Wednesday 2nd January 2019 for 12 weeks until Monday 22nd April 2019. The carriageway will be restricted to one lane via the use of a barrier system for 150 meters either side of the bridge and also there will be a temporary speed reduction from NSL/60mph down to 30mph for 200 meters either side of the bridge.

There will be a programme of road closures during some weekends at the start and end of the project, these will be required to setup the site compound and install the traffic management systems and likewise at the end to dismantle.

The programme of road closure we propose is as follows. Please do note that not all of the proposed road closures will be required, however, we require to have them reserved and road space clear as this is a high risk project which does not allow for a delay of any kind. Please also find attached the proposed diversion route which will affect your parish jurisdictions during the any road closures.

  • 20:00 Friday 4th January 2019 to 05:00 Monday 7th January 2019.
  • 20:00 Friday 11th January 2019 to 05:00 Monday 14th January 2019.
  • 20:00 Friday 18th January 2019 to 05:00 Monday 21st January 2019.
  • 21:00 on Friday 29th March 2019 to 05:00 on Monday 1st April 2019
  • 21:00 on Friday 5th April 2019 to 05:00 on Monday 8th April 2019
  • 21:00 on Friday 12th April 2019 to 05:00 on Monday 15th April 2019
  • 21:00 on Friday 19th April 2019 to 05:00 on Monday 22nd April 2019
